Black Mountain Academy is a year-round therapeutic boarding school supporting neurodiverse high school students—primarily assigned male at birth—in developing essential social, emotional, academic, and life skills.
Our relationship-based, hands-on learning approach empowers students to grow, explore, and thrive in a safe and supportive environment. We specialize in helping adolescents who experience challenges related to learning differences, social skills, executive functioning, and emotional regulation.
